West Ham plan Icardi bid
West Ham plan Icardi bid
Inter Milan striker Mauro Icardi has emerged as a surprise target for West Ham United this summer. The club are eager to bring in a top-class striker ahead of their move to the Olympic Stadium.
The Hammers have had a great campaign under Slaven Bilic this term, and will look to bank on the success next season.
According to The Mirror, the East London side have switched their focus to Icardi after they were priced out of a move for Marseille ace Michy Batshuayi.
Marseille had placed their striker at a hefty value of £32m and this put off the Hammers.
On the other hand, Icardi could be available at a fee of around £20m and this is likely to attract competition from several European clubs.
West Ham are currently sixth in the league standings.
